    Jarvis fuels pregnancy rumour, spotted at kidswear store: “the baby is coming”

    Jarvis has got social media buzzing after she was spotted in a babywear shop.

    There, she made a cryptic comment that has fans wondering if she’s expecting a child with her partner and fellow streamer, Peller. The viral clip, captured during a casual shopping vlog, showed the influencer having a light-hearted exchange with a female store attendant, but it’s what she said that raised eyebrows. In the video, Jarvis is seen asking about the right shoe size for a baby. The salesgirl, seemingly curious, asks, “Is the baby newly born?”

    Jarvis, without missing a beat, responds, “The baby is coming.” The phrase alone would have been enough to spark speculation, but it’s what followed that sent fans over the edge. Jarvis jokingly compared her boyfriend Peller’s head size to that of the expected baby.
